THE MOST TRUSTED GUIDE TO GETTING POETRY PUBLISHEDWant to get your poetry published?

There's no better tool for making it happen than Poet's Market 2016, which includes hundreds of publishing opportunities specifically for poets, including listings for book and chapbook publishers, poetry publications, contests, and more.

These listings include contact information, submission preferences, insider tips on what specific editors want, and--when offered--payment information.
